Job Overview

Job Title: Site Manager - Passive Fire

Location: Midlands

Salary: Competitive + benefits

Established in 1989, our client is the UK's leading passive fire protection specialist, supplying a comprehensive range of third‑party accredited survey, installation and compliance services to public and private sector organisations across the country.

With offices nationwide, this is a great opportunity to join a forward‑thinking, modern construction business that genuinely cares about its people.

Responsibilities

As the Site Manager, you will supervise and manage the contractors' undertaking works, ensuring the works are completed in a safe and efficient manner within stated timescales.

You will be responsible for management of sub‑contractors, inspecting properties pre and post works, taking progress meetings and overseeing the day‑to‑day delivery of the programme.

Requirements & Qualifications
  • SMSTS
  • First Aid
  • CSCS Card
  • Asbestos Awareness (preferred)
  • Able to gain Security Clearance
  • IOSH
  • Relevant Fire Qualification preferred but not essential (BM Trada, FIRAS, NVQ Passive Fire)
  • Fire Door Knowledge
